Mariners’ Playoff Drought in Jeopardy

About a month ago, the Seattle Mariners were 29-39 and on a collision course to another year with no playoffs. But since their infamous brawl against the Los Angeles Angels on June 26, Seattle is 15-3 and in the midst of a 12-game win streak.

Suddenly, the Mariners’ MLB playoff odds are skyrocketing as they enter the day in possession of the second Wild Card spot.

This winning streak isn’t necessarily a product of an explosive offense. Seattle still ranks 22nd in runs and 24th in batting average over the course of the season.

However, the M’s haven’t allowed more than five runs in any game throughout their win streak. As a result, their ERA and WHIP now rank fifth and seventh, respectively.

Logan Gilbert, one of Seattle’s promising pitchers, is starting. The big righty is 10-3 with a 2.80 ERA, 1.17 WHIP, and 100 strikeouts in 106.0 innings.

Rangers Aim to Get Back on the Horse

For a while, it seemed like the Texas Rangers would be able to overcome their 6-14 start after nearly clawing back to .500 last month. However, a 5-9 record in July has pushed Texas further back, especially with the Seattle Mariners’ win streak going on in the same span.

Despite their pedestrian record, the Rangers rank a solid 14th in runs and 19th in batting average. The pitching staff, however, is a different story. Texas sits 22nd in ERA and 21st in WHIP, which has undoubtedly been affected by the Rangers giving up six runs or more in eight of their last 11 contests.

Spencer Howard will be tasked with snapping Seattle’s streak. Howard recently returned to action following a two-month absence and carries an 8.04 ERA and 1.66 WHIP in 15.2 innings.

Mariners vs Rangers Head-to-Head

Even before their win streak began, the Seattle Mariners dominated the Texas Rangers in 2022. Seattle was 4-2 against Texas before winning the first two games of this series.

The Mariners beating the Rangers is nothing new for MLB picks experts. Seattle has won four of the last five season series against its division foe and has gone 27-10 against them since the start of 2020.

Mariners vs Rangers Prediction

The Seattle Mariners are the hottest team in baseball and have the superior pitcher on the bump. Yet the MLB lines only have them pegged at -145 on the Moneyline, while the Texas Rangers are +130.

One possible explanation could be the difference in run-line performance. Even though Seattle is now seven games over .500, it’s just 14-24 in covering as run line favorites. Meanwhile, Texas is a scrappy 37-18 as run line underdogs.

Of course, that doesn’t take recent play much into account. The Mariners are shutting down all of their recent opponents, while the Rangers can’t shut down any lineup they face.
